solidity/test/libsolidity/semanticTests/consteval_array_length.sol

15 lines
253 B
Solidity

contract C {
uint constant a = 12;
uint constant b = 10;
function f() public pure returns (uint) {
uint[(a / b) * b] memory x;
return x.length;
}
}
// ====
// compileViaYul: true
// ----
// constructor() ->
// f() -> 10